Oftentimes, the writing process can feel like a lonely, monumental task. To make writing feel less daunting, graduate writers may be looking for sources of support and strategies to work more efficiently or get the process started.
These vidcasts introduce small interventions that may make writing more enjoyable—or at least more achievable. With strategies like “Life Mapping,” SMART goal setting, as well as motivational productivity methods, sources of writing support, and recommendations for requesting writing feedback, we hope graduate writers will feel empowered as they work on any writing task.
